    Short Term Construction Loan

    I have a local builder, building a spec home (value is 6 mill) and they need a quick 32k for a concrete pour that went bad.

    They only need it for 30 days. I have no idea on what to charge for cost. A little out of my element here, have an attorney working on docs.

    I am going to get it done, but need some ideas.

    Any input would be appreciated.

    Being that concrete is poured at the very start of the project- something doesn't seem right. Since you said 'Spec' Does the builder have a construction loan that pays progress payments? If yes it seems that he doesn't have any credit with his subs- or that the word is that he doesn't pay his contractors.. Make sense? Seems weird that he's light Capital now- at the beginning of the project.

    Micah's idea is spot on but I'm guessing the credit isn't stellar

    wow, i would be concerned that he doesnt have 30K liquid for a construction project thats estimated at $6MM, i fund groud up all the time and require that the borrower has 10% Liquid to start the project untul the draws start clearing..

    So, i pulled credit, I am not touching this deal. 512, tons of collections. 215k fed tax lien.

    Its unreal, he told me he had a tax lien, when i asked if it was fed or state he did not know.

    Other red flags, his website is garbage. His partner was super rude on the phone with me. When I told him about pulling credit, he said well, my partner could sign. I was not doing business with her.

    So, yes dead deal. Thanks for all the input.
